最新文章列表

使用Fiddler为满足某些特定格式的网络请求返回mock响应

假设我想对本地Java程序发起的调用SAP Hybris web service https://jerrywang.com:9002/rest/v2/electronics/users/ 这个网络请求生成一个mock响应。 在Fiddler session监控列表里,找到要生成mock响应的请求,进入AutoResponder标签页,将Enable rules前面的勾选中,创建一条新的rule ...
JerryWang_SAP 评论(0) 有425人浏览 2019-12-30 12:11

单元测试特殊场景代码示例

最近在教研发部小伙伴写单元测试发现,大部门常见的Service、DAO层的Mock大家是会的,但是一些特殊情况问问无从下手,下边巨蟹栗子: case1:MultipartFile 被测试方法: public String getUploadOSSUrl(String path, MultipartFile file) throws IOException {byte[] bytes = fi ...
aoyouzi 评论(0) 有842人浏览 2017-12-13 15:10

php单元测试进阶(11)- 核心技术 - 桩件(stub) - 不使用桩件

php单元测试进阶(11)- 核心技术 - 桩件(stub) - 不使用桩件 本系列文章主要代码与文字来源于《单元测试的艺术》,原作者:Roy Osherove。译者:金迎。 本系列文章根据php的语法与使用习惯做了改编。所有代码在本机测试通过。如转载请注明出处。 上文介绍了通过创建一个局部的方法调用返回桩件,然后测试时用派生的子类来进行测试。 但是对于本文的示例来说,还有更简单的办法,不用桩件 ...
xieye 评论(0) 有619人浏览 2017-07-31 20:45

Junit,Mockito,PowerMockito 进行单元测试

编写不易,转载请注明( http://shihlei.iteye.com/blog/2383925)!   概述:     介绍基于Junit ,Mockito,PowerMockito 常用的测试方法,包括异常测试,私有方法测试,没有返回值的方法测试,基于mock或spy的测试;     其中包含常规方法mock,私有方法mock。  一 测试介绍 1)测试原则:         ...
ShihLei 评论(0) 有3080人浏览 2017-07-10 18:52

About powermock static

mock官网:https://github.com/powermock/powermock/wiki/SuppressUnwantedBehavior —————————————抑制static{}——————————————————— Suppress static initializer Some times a thrid-party class does something in its ...
hekuilove 评论(0) 有846人浏览 2017-03-30 11:40

SpringMVC测试框架Mock[转载]

  基于RESTful风格的SpringMVC的测试,我们可以测试完整的Spring MVC流程,即从URL请求到控制器处理,再到视图渲染都可以测试。 一 MockMvcBuilder MockMvcBuilder是用来构造MockMvc的构造器,其主要有两个实现:StandaloneMockMvcBuilder和DefaultMockMvcBuilder,分别对应两种测试方式,即独立安装和 ...
vtrtbb 评论(0) 有2760人浏览 2017-02-22 15:09

mockto简单入门

一、什么是mock测试,什么是mock对象?   先来看看下面这个示例: 从上图可以看出如果我们要对A进行测试,那么就要先把整个依赖树构建出来,也就是BCDE的实例。   一种替代方案就是使用mocks 从图中可以清晰的看出 mock对象就是在调试期间用来作为真实对象的替代品。 mock测试就是在测试过程中,对那些不容易构建的对象用一个虚拟对象来代替测试的方法就叫mock ...
zhongmin2012 评论(0) 有819人浏览 2017-01-03 09:55

mockito+testng Mock Redis

package yy.xx.redis;   import org.apache.log4j.Logger; import org.springframework.stereotype.Repository;   import redis.clients.jedis.Jedis; import redis.clients.jedis.JedisPool;     @Reposit ...
aoyouzi 评论(0) 有4846人浏览 2016-11-17 10:40

mockito+testng Mock HttpServletRequest

法2 org.springframework.mock.web.MockHttpServletRequest; org.springframework.mock.web.MockHttpServletResponse; 法1 package com.xxx.ttt;   import javax.servlet.http.HttpServletRequest;   imp ...
aoyouzi 评论(0) 有2741人浏览 2016-11-16 16:02

mockit

简介 一、什么是mock测试,什么是mock对象?   先来看看下面这个示例: 从上图可以看出如果我们要对A进行测试,那么就要先把整个依赖树构建出 ...
zhongmin2012 评论(0) 有849人浏览 2016-09-08 18:06

测试驱动开发实践 - Test-Driven Development(转)

测试驱动开发实践 - Test-Driven Development(转) 一.前言 不知道大家有没听过“测试先行的开发”这一说法,作为一种开发实践,在过去进行开发时,一般是先开发用户界面或者是类,然后再在此基础上编写测试。 但在TDD中,首先是进行测试用例的编写,然后再进行类或者用户界面的开发。由于要先开发测试用例,那么开发人员就必须清楚测试的目的,所测功能模块的业务逻辑以及需要 ...
zhongmin2012 评论(1) 有1101人浏览 2016-09-06 10:25

Mock

mock分享ppt
Dragonmandance 评论(0) 有616人浏览 2016-07-01 10:47

Android异步函数单元测试

大部分内容也适合Java,此处主要是对sdk类别的module做unit test,不涉及UI   1. 配置 1) 对于涉及到android原生的类库返回默认的对象,否则,之后遇到Log之类的语句都需要手动mock,但是不要期待这个配置对android API提供全面的支持   testOptions { unitTests.returnDefaultValues = tr ...
xuanzhui 评论(0) 有3850人浏览 2015-12-23 12:11

EasyMock让单元测试更"解耦"

1,概念:我们用EasyMock就是为了模拟程序中因为要进行单元测试而做的很多复杂的"事儿"~                  比如我们程序中有一段程序 ...
zhangliguoaccp 评论(0) 有1237人浏览 2015-10-08 14:11

junit单元测试3:springockito

       接http://baowp.iteye.com/blog/1988249,前文举例了一个使用mockito在spring管理的实例中注入一个mock对象的情况,但是仅限于直接引用的对象且要写MockitoAnnotations.initMocks(this)使其生效。        如何能够与spring结合得更深,就像是注入spring bean一样地注入mock对象,这样对于 ...
baowp 评论(1) 有3753人浏览 2014-05-30 16:46

Mockito 初探

 一. 简介 1.背景         Mockito是一个流行的Mocking(模拟测试)框架,通过使用Mocking框架,可以尽可能使unit test独立的。unit test保持独立的好处不在这里讨论。     官方文档: http://docs.mockito.googlecode.com/hg/latest/org/mockito/Mockito.html    2.S ...
sgq0085 评论(2) 有20717人浏览 2014-03-17 12:46

对于单元测试的一些新认识

    我也忘了怎么机缘巧合的看到了Martin Fowler先生的这篇大作:Mocks Aren't Stubs。确实写的深刻,使我对单元测试的目的和方式又有了新的认识。     ...
power1128 评论(0) 有1567人浏览 2013-11-20 09:56

PowerMock使用分享

单元测试是对应用中的某一个模块的功能进行验证。在单元测试中,我们常遇到的问题是依赖的模块尚未开发完成或者被测试模块需要和一些不容易构造、比较复杂的对象进行交互。另外,由于不能肯定其它模块的正确性,我们也无法确定测试中发现的问题是由哪个模块引起的。所谓的mock,就是指,如果我们写的代码依赖于某些对象,而这些对象又很难手动创建,那么就使用一个虚拟的对象来完成单元测试。在java界现在比较流行的mock ...
qicen 评论(1) 有7219人浏览 2013-08-06 17:14

NSubstitute完全手册索引

原帖地址:http://www.cnblogs.com/gaochundong/archive/2013/05/22/nsubstitute_manual.htmlNSubstitute 是什么? NSubstitute 是一个 .NET Mocking 类库。 一直以来,开发者对 mocking 类库的语法的简洁性有强烈的渴望,NSubstitute 试图满足这一需求。简单明了的语法可以让我们将重 ...
wyqj 评论(0) 有700人浏览 2013-05-22 15:50

最近博客热门TAG

Java(141747) C(73651) C++(68608) SQL(64571) C#(59609) XML(59133) HTML(59043) JavaScript(54918) .net(54785) Web(54513) 工作(54116) Linux(50906) Oracle(49876) 应用服务器(43288) Spring(40812) 编程(39454) Windows(39381) JSP(37542) MySQL(37268) 数据结构(36423)

博客人气排行榜

    博客电子书下载排行

      >>浏览更多下载

      相关资讯

      相关讨论

      Global site tag (gtag.js) - Google Analytics